A WOMAN has died after a collision outside a Tesco store.

Police said the 45-year-old woman died on Monday as a result of her injuries from the incident on November 21.

Emergency services rushed to Tesco in Lottbridge Drove, where the woman, a pedestrian, was seriously injured in a collision with a VW campervan in the car park at around 2.45pm.

The vehicle was driven by a 58-year-old man from Eastbourne.

In the days after the incident, police released an appeal for witnesses or anyone with mobile phone or dash-cam images of what happened.
